How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Elmhurst?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Elmhurst Studio Apartments | $2,899 | $1,860 | $10,000+ |
| Elmhurst 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,760 | $1,100 | $8,000 |
| Elmhurst 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,064 | $2,400 | $5,584 |
| Elmhurst 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,564 | $2,500 | $6,050 |
| Elmhurst 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,077 | $3,200 | $4,695 |
| Elmhurst 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,197 | $5,895 | $6,500 |
| Elmhurst 6 Bedroom Apartments | $6,000 | $6,000 | $6,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Elmhurst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Elmhurst with Studio?
Currently the most affordable Studio in Elmhurst is at Woodside Central listed at $2,675.
How much is the average rent for a Studio Elmhurst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Elmhurst is $2,899.
What is the largest available Studio Elmhurst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Elmhurst is a 619 square feet unit starting from $2,931 at Parker Towers.
What is the average size for Elmhurst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Elmhurst is currently 441 sq ft.
